Bukit Haji Hassan
Bukit Haji Hassan is a hill in Kemaman District, Terengganu and has an elevation of 27 metres. Bukit Haji Hassan is situated nearby to the locality Kampung Kolam, as well as near Kampung Teluk Nyiur.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Chukai, also known by the name of Kemaman Town, is a mukim and capital of Kemaman District, Terengganu, Malaysia. The name "Chukai" means 'taxes' in Malay.

Cherating is a popular beach resort area in Pahang. It is located about 30 km north of Kuantan on Peninsular Malaysia's East Coast. Cherating village is a typical small lazy East Coast fishing village although backpacker-tourism now is the major income earner here.
